    Biography:

    Dr. Rahman was born on December 22, 1976, in Sylhet, to his father, Tayabur Rahman, and mother, Maya Begum. He was one of seven children—five boys and two girls. He started his career in 2002 as a lecturer in statistics at the M.C. Academy, Golapgonj, Sylhet. In 2004, he joined the department of statistics, SUST, as a lecturer. Later, he became an assistant professor in 2007. After he had been appointed as an associate professor in 2015, he was promoted to professor in 2018.
